Ceramic Release Agent
Ceramic release agents are primarily used to prevent ceramic products from adhering to molds during the forming process, ensuring smooth demolding, while also guaranteeing the surface quality of the products and production efficiency. Release agents play a crucial role in ceramic production.
Classification and Characteristics
Ceramic release agents are mainly divided into two categories: organic release agents and inorganic release agents:
Organic Release Agents:
Release Oils: Suitable for the production of ordinary ceramics and special ceramics, insoluble in water, they form a protective film on the sintered ceramic surface, preventing premature hardening and cracking of the ceramic body. However, release oils are difficult to clean and may remain on the ceramic body, affecting its smoothness and the quality of subsequent sintering.
Polytetrafluoroethylene (PTFE) Release Agents: Colorless, transparent, non-flammable, capable of withstanding high temperatures and high pressure, they effectively prevent the ceramic body from sticking to the mold, making the surface of ceramic products smoother and easier to clean. However, they are more expensive and suitable for the production of high-end ceramics.
Inorganic Release Agents:
Phosphate Release Agents: Colorless, odorless, non-toxic, and easy to dilute, suitable for the production of high-end ceramics and special ceramics. They can be thoroughly cleaned without leaving residues on the ceramic body, ensuring no impact on the smoothness and subsequent sintering quality.
Silicate Release Agents: Highly compatible with ceramic raw materials, suitable for various types of ceramic production. They effectively prevent mold sticking during the sintering process, resulting in a smoother ceramic surface.
Usage Methods and Effects
The typical method of using release agents involves applying an appropriate amount evenly onto the mold surface to form a隔离膜 (isolation film). This allows the ceramic product to be easily demolded after forming, ensuring surface quality and production efficiency. Different types of release agents vary in effectiveness: organic release agents like release oils and PTFE are suitable for high-end ceramic production, while inorganic release agents like phosphates and silicates are applicable to various types of ceramic production.
